CHANGELOG 3.7.0 — Renamed setting for the Tallgrove partner SFTP drop. Old key DROPBOX_SFTP_PASS removed; replaced to align with the Bramleigh naming convention and to separate transport credentials from path configuration. Migration: delete the old key from all env files, confirm no references remain in the Harkness deploy scripts, then add the renamed key. No behavior change; same rotation cadence applies. Reviewers should verify the old key is absent from the audit export before sign-off. Set the renamed credential on the next line.

vault entry, yahif-yajep: COURIER_KEY29=b802bdf8034096b65a51c6ba5abe2

Subject: Quick read-out — Eastbank region numbers

Hi all,

Just wrapped the Eastbank sales review with the branch managers. Good news: Marlowe Park and Tethering both beat target; Cinderhill lagged again, mostly staffing. We're shifting one senior rep over and tightening the promo calendar. Full slides coming Friday. Branch managers, hold off on sharing anything beyond your own numbers. Context for that is in the confidential note below.

board note of kageg-bahof: The renewal with Holwynax Holdings closes at $2 million a year, 5 percent below the last contract. Project Ulaath slips by two quarters because of the supplier delay.

# Coldpath handler env config — on-call notes
# Our serverless handlers on the Brimvale runtime cold-start slowly
# when the warmer pool is exhausted. Symptoms: p99 spikes past 4s,
# usually after a deploy or a regional failover.
# Mitigation: the Embertide prewarmer pings each handler every 90s.
# Do NOT raise the ping interval above 120s; cold starts return fast.
# The prewarmer authenticates against the invoke gateway.
# Its credential goes on the next line:

env line for bahaf-haweg: RELAY_SECRET20=f2449cd5df523296d3f4